Output d65d6a692018d2e68ae738fb86d7a60ea1d0c2b30af6c59f9e8d63b3cb011759:0

value
17870561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7ecb193e91f1dc60c5966edbbe2b583c27df5f1 OP_EQUAL
address
3JTX8QtkcbLqDTawFpzTqLcLA5hwQkXyWr
transaction
d65d6a692018d2e68ae738fb86d7a60ea1d0c2b30af6c59f9e8d63b3cb011759
spent
true